Fix Sagging Acoustic Tiles: Causes & Repair Guide

That subtle dip in your office or basement ceiling isn’t just an eyesore—it’s a sign your acoustic tile system is failing its core jobs: sound absorption, fire resistance, and moisture management. Sagging tiles often indicate underlying issues like water exposure, aging suspension systems, or improper installation. Ignoring it risks tile collapse, mold growth, or compromised acoustics—especially in rooms like home theaters or conference spaces.

Quick Diagnosis

Before grabbing tools, identify the root cause. Most sagging stems from one (or more) of these:

  • Water damage from roof leaks, HVAC condensation, or plumbing above the ceiling
  • Rusted or bent grid components (main tees, cross tees, or hanger wires)
  • Overloaded grid from heavy fixtures or added insulation
  • Tile age—mineral fiber tiles lose structural integrity after 15–20 years
  • Poor initial installation: undersized hangers, missing clips, or uneven joist anchoring

Step-by-Step Fix

Choose the method based on severity and cause:

  1. Re-tension the grid: Loosen adjacent cross tees, lift sagging section, and re-seat into main tees using new grid clips. Tighten hanger wire nuts at ceiling joists—don’t overtighten; aim for 1/8" clearance between tile and grid lip.
  2. Replace damaged tiles: Remove warped or water-stained tiles (wear N95 mask—older tiles may contain fiberglass). Measure diagonally: if variance exceeds 1/16", discard. Install matching 2'×2' or 2'×4' mineral fiber tiles with 0.5" clearance around edges.
  3. Reinforce hanger wires: For grids sagging >3/8" across a 10-ft span, add supplemental hangers every 4 ft along main tees. Use 12-gauge galvanized wire anchored into solid joists—not drywall or plaster.
  4. Dry and stabilize: If moisture is present, run a dehumidifier at 45% RH for 72 hours before reinstalling tiles. Test with moisture meter: tile core must read <12% MC (per ASTM D4216-22).

When to Call a Pro

DIY stops where safety and code compliance begin. Call a licensed contractor if:

  • You find standing water or active leaks above the ceiling—this requires roofing or plumbing repair first
  • The grid shows widespread rust, pitting, or fractured welds (common in pre-1990 installations)
  • More than 30% of tiles show delamination, crumbling edges, or black mold (≥1 sq ft patches require EPA-certified abatement per NIOSH 2021 guidelines)
  • Your building has sprinkler heads, fire-rated assemblies, or integrated HVAC ductwork embedded in the ceiling plane

Prevention Tips

Extend your ceiling’s life by addressing conditions—not just symptoms:

  • Install a vapor barrier above insulation in unconditioned attics to block seasonal condensation
  • Check HVAC drip pans quarterly; clean condensate lines with white vinegar every 6 months
  • Use only UL-listed LED troffer retrofits—halogen or older fluorescent fixtures generate excess heat that warps tiles
  • Label hanger wire locations on joists with chalk after installation so future adjustments don’t rely on guesswork

Can I glue sagging tiles back in place?

Yes—but only if the tile is intact and dry. Use a water-based acoustic tile adhesive applied with a notched trowel (1/8" x 1/8" V-notch), then press firmly for 60 seconds. Never use construction adhesive or silicone: they trap moisture and degrade mineral fiber over time. According to the National Gypsum Company’s 2023 Technical Bulletin, improperly bonded tiles fail acoustically within 18 months due to micro-fractures.

Why do my tiles sag only in winter?

This points to thermal cycling and humidity swings. Cold attic air meets warm interior air at the ceiling plane, causing condensation inside the grid cavity. The U.S. Department of Energy estimates that 22% of residential ceiling failures occur during December–February due to this effect. Add rigid foam baffles between rafters to maintain airflow and install a smart humidistat set to 30–40% RH.

Do all acoustic tiles have the same weight capacity?

No. Standard 15/16" mineral fiber tiles weigh 1.2–1.5 lbs/sq ft, while fiberglass panels range from 0.7–1.0 lbs/sq ft. Heavy-duty vinyl-faced tiles can hit 2.3 lbs/sq ft—exceeding most legacy grids’ 1.8-lb/sq-ft load rating. Always check your grid’s manufacturer spec sheet: Armstrong’s Ceilings Division notes that grids installed before 2005 often lack reinforcement for modern high-density tiles.

How long should acoustic tiles last before replacement?

Mineral fiber tiles last 15–20 years under ideal conditions (stable RH, no UV exposure, no physical impact). However, the Insurance Institute for Business & Home Safety's 2023 report found that 68% of commercial buildings replace tiles early due to performance loss—not visible damage—specifically reduced NRC (Noise Reduction Coefficient) below 0.55 after year 12.

Can I paint acoustic tiles to hide stains?

Avoid it. Paint seals pores and cuts sound absorption by up to 40%, per ASTM E492-21 testing. Stains usually indicate moisture or mold—painting hides the problem but accelerates decay. Instead, replace stained tiles and investigate the moisture source. If aesthetics matter, choose pre-finished tiles with antimicrobial coatings like USG’s EcoWhite Plus.

Is it safe to walk on the grid to reach sagging areas?

No. Ceiling grids are not rated for foot traffic. Even light pressure bends main tees, misaligns cross tees, and loosens hanger connections. Use a sturdy ladder with stabilizer arms—or rent a rolling scaffold with 36" platform clearance. The Occupational Safety and Health Administration (OSHA) cites unsupported grid contact as a top-5 cause of ceiling-related workplace injuries in office renovations.
